My Dad passed away this morning at 5:55. He was 80 years old, the only child of a coal miner. A WWII Navy veteran, he operated radios and sonar equipment late in the war. He graduated from West Virginia University in 1950. Charles Berkley Ferguson was married to my mom for 55 years, and raised 3 sons. He had 8 grandchildren and 3 great grandchildren. He was a musician by avocation, playing the piano, and was a very good singer. Many folks were married, or laid to rest to his singing. He was also a real ham and enjoyed entertaining people. He directed many fundraising talent shows through the years to raise money for the Hospital, Association for Retarded Citizens and the Jaycees.
He is in a much better place now, and is no longer the frail old man that he had become.
He will be missed.
